This article unpicks how the fastest payouts actually work, who&#8217;s leading the charge, and what punters should suss out before signing up.<\/p>\n<h2>How Same Hour Withdrawals Actually Work Behind The Curtain<\/h2>\n<p>Most players assume a quick payout is a magic button the casino presses, but the reality is a chain of systems that have to line up. The casino&#8217;s internal payments team has to approve the cashout, the payment processor has to flag it as clean, and the receiving bank or e-wallet has to accept the transfer. When all three run smoothly, the money lands in minutes. When one drags, the whole chain stalls.<\/p>\n<p>In Australia, the Interactive Gambling Act 2001 shapes a lot of this behind-the-scenes plumbing. The brand&#8217;s crypto rails process withdrawals almost as fast as a TAB account settles at 6pm on a Friday, and the POLi fallback covers punters who aren&#8217;t riding the Bitcoin wave.<\/p>\n<h2>Payment Methods That Actually Deliver Same Hour Results<\/h2>\n<p>Not every banking option is built the same, and choosing the wrong one can undo a casino&#8217;s best efforts. Crypto, when the operator&#8217;s wallet is properly configured and the blockchain isn&#8217;t congested, is the fastest. Bitcoin and Ethereum transactions typically confirm within 10-30 minutes, though network fees can sting on a quiet Tuesday morning. Litecoin and Tether are the quiet achievers here, often clearing in under 10 minutes for a fraction of the cost.<\/p>\n<p>E-wallets like Skrill, Neteller and MiFinity sit in the middle tier. Provided the player&#8217;s account is fully verified, withdrawals usually process inside an hour. The catch is that e-wallets add a layer between the casino and the player&#8217;s actual bank, which means a second hop before the money&#8217;s truly spendable at the local bottle-o or servo.<\/p>\n<p>POLi and PayID are the homegrown heroes. POLi links directly to the player&#8217;s Australian bank account, and PayID uses the New Payments Platform (NPP) to settle in real time. Most Aussie-facing operators now offer at least one of these, and they&#8217;re the go-to for punters who&#8217;d rather not fiddle with crypto wallets or share card details across half a dozen sites. Bank wires remain the slowest option, often taking two to five business days, so they&#8217;re best avoided unless the player is moving a chunky amount and isn&#8217;t fussed on timing.<\/p>\n<h2>Aussie Rules And Red Tape Worth Knowing<\/h2>\n<p>The local regulatory environment is a weird beast. Operators who ignore that reality don&#8217;t last long in this market.&#8221;<\/p>\n<h2>Spotting The Genuine Quick Cashout Sites From The Pretenders<\/h2>\n<p>A few telltale signs separate the legit operators from the flashy pretenders. First, check the withdrawal page before depositing a cent. If it buries payout times behind three layers of T&amp;Cs or talks vaguely about &#8220;processing windows&#8221;, that&#8217;s a red flag. The genuine brands publish specific timeframes for each payment method, often right on the homepage or FAQ.<\/p>\n<p>Second, look at the bonus terms. Sites that lock withdrawals behind 40x or 50x wagering requirements on bonuses are structurally designed to delay payouts. The fairer brands keep wagering requirements around 30x and clearly outline which games contribute what percentage. Third, scan independent review sites and player forums for recent payout complaints. A single grumble is noise; a pattern across multiple threads is a fair dinkum warning.<\/p>\n<p>Finally, test the waters with a small withdrawal before committing to a big bankroll. Deposit $50, play a few spins on the pokies, then request a $30 withdrawal. If the money lands inside the hour, you&#8217;ve found a keeper. If it takes three days and a barrage of support emails, move on.
